JADE

The Emergency Department waiting room was enormous, with four distinct seating areas spread out in front of us. Several closed triage doors lined the walls, and a large reception desk sat at the center of it all, guarded by an imposing police officer stationed behind a thick glass shield. As we approached, a receptionist emerged from a set of automatic, locked wooden doors, her face lighting up with a warm smile until her gaze landed on us.

To our right, there were only a few people, huddled together in a corner wearing surgical masks. Two women beside a man in a wheelchair caught my eye; slumped over with his eyes closed, his legs covered with a sheet. In stark contrast to the quiet scene before us, Nico was alone on the other side, pacing back and forth with his arms crossed defensively over his chest. A scene I’d never thought I’d witness from him. As soon as he spotted us, he rushed over to greet us.

“Follow me,” he demanded in a low voice as not to raise suspicion before giving a nod to the receptionist and policeman.

Nurses rushed past with medical equipment, while paramedics stood next to a person on a stretcher, their voices friendly but demanding. The sound of machines beeping and people talking filled the air. We followed Nico down the hall, dodging busy staff members until we reached a left turn. We veered off into a private waiting area, away from the chaos of the main hospital ward.

My heart dropped when I saw Tyler sitting in the corner, his face pale and strained. Jenna was next to him, her arms wrapped tightly around him as she held him close. Ian and Chance stood nearby, their expressions grave, their eyes red-rimmed.

Panic rose in my chest. No, no no no.

Jenna made eye contact with me, tears streaming down her cheeks as she silently conveyed the gravity of the situation. Ian stepped over to us, his jaw tight and his hands clenched at his sides as he tried to hold back his emotions. Nico positioned himself near the door, a silent sentry keeping watch.

“What happened?” I hissed, not wanting to cause more upset than there already was in the room.

Luke pulled me against his side. Giovanna on the other side of me, craned her neck toward the others before bringing her gaze back to Ian. He cleared his throat ever so slightly as Chance took a stance next to him, rigid with anger and sadness.

“Mila got a call that her sister had another fall and was in the hospital. She told Ty to stay with the kids and she’d be fine. He insisted on going with her, anyway. After a heated argument over him staying behind and watching the kids, she left anyway and was T-boned.”

My eyes welled up with tears at the news. “Is she?—”

“She’s in surgery right now,” he added grimly.

“Where are the kids?” Luke asked, concern etched on his face.

Chance nodded toward the door. “Amber and Ice Man took them to get some snacks from the vending machine as a distraction.”

Giovanna laid a hand on my arm. “Excuse me,” her voice cracked as she made her way over to Tyler, squatting down in front of him. She laid a hand on his knee. “I’m so sorry.”

He lifted his gaze to her, his eyes narrowing in rage by the second. “Get the fuck away from me!” he barked.

Whoa! The sudden outburst startled us, causing our heads to snap in their direction. Jenna lurched backward in her chair while Giovanna collapsed ungracefully onto the floor with a thud.

“I’m sorry,” Giovanna stammered, her voice trembling with emotion. “I just wanted to give you my heartfelt?—”

“Really, Gia?!” he spat, his words dripping with venom. “You don’t even know me! Why the fuck are you even here?! You don’t even belong here! There’s no reason under the sun that you should be here at all!”

“Hey!” Luke finally snapped at him, his voice laced with anger and frustration. Tyler lifted his gaze to meet Luke’s, his expression seething with rage. “I understand you’re upset, as we all are about the situation. But there’s no reason to speak to her that way unless there’s something that I don’t know about.”

Tyler opened his mouth to respond, but before he could, Giovanna stood up from the floor, smoothing out her disheveled attire. “It’s okay, Luke,” she said calmly. “It’s probably best that I’m not here right now. I don’t want to add to the stress.” She glanced at Tyler briefly before turning back to face Luke. “If he wants me to go, I will.”

“You’re not going anywhere,” Luke asserted firmly. “Whoever is out there has seen you with us, and you’ve got a target on your back now, too.”

“She can stay,” Tyler muttered, staring at the floor, his hands propping up his head. “I’m just—” his voice trailed off, and he didn’t finish his thought.

Ian took a step toward her. “Sit.”

She hesitated for a moment before nodding and taking a seat in a nearby chair against the wall just as the door opened. We all twisted toward it, eager for any news from the doctor, but it was Amber with Mila and Tyler’s kids. He did his best to wipe away all sadness as he offered them a smile. He pulled Naya into his lap while Evan and Jackson plopped down on the floor in front of him against the wall. Naya offered her dad some of her fruit snacks, to which he politely declined, holding her a little tighter. She buried her hand in the bag, taking one out and popping it into her mouth.

We waited.

And waited.

And waited.

An hour passed. Naya had moved over to Jenna’s lap and fallen asleep with her head on her shoulder. Across the room, Evan lay curled up on an L-shaped couch, his chest rising and falling with a steady rhythm. Jackson had dozed off at the other end, his head resting against a throw pillow. Suddenly, the door opened again, and the surgeon emerged with two nurses at his side.
